Cal State 糖心vlog安卓破解 posts second runner-up finish of the season at Westmont Invitational
- September 25, 2010
SANTA BARBRARA, Calif. - A solid team effort enabled the Pioneer women’s cross country team to finish second at the Westmont Invitational on Sept. 25. Led by sophomore Megan McDaniel’s third straight fourth-place showing, Cal State 糖心vlog安卓破解 defeated four teams in the six-team field.
The Pioneers compiled a team score of 36, seven points behind first place Westmont College. 糖心vlog安卓破解 finished ahead of third place Fresno Pacific by 49 points and defeated three other teams.
"The girls ran a solid race," CSUEB Head Coach Greg Ryan said. "We improved by 20 seconds over year’s race."
糖心vlog安卓破解 had five runners place in the top 10, including McDaniel’s fourth-place performance and Amanda McNabb’s fifth-place showing. McDaniel covered the 5K course in 20:25.0, while McNabb recorded a time of 20:30.
Bernadette Lu (21:02), Nancy Velazquez (21:17.0) and Tiffany Duffy (21:22.0) finished eighth, ninth, and 10th, respectively.
Clarivel Vega clocked 22:34 to finish 16th, while Nastassia Hamor placed 21st in 23:24 to round out a strong Pioneer performance.
"Megan was our top runner while Amanda ran a strong race," Ryan said. "Bernadette had a good outing as well as Nancy and Tiffany."
